For the academic year 2022-2023, the average acceptance rate of two rivalry schools is 50.88%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 16.58%. A total of 25,800 have applied, 13,126 admitted, and 2,176 students have enrolled one of University Of San Diego Vs Pepperdine University.

Pepperdine University is the tightest school to admit with 48.71% acceptance rate, and University of San Diego has the second lowest acceptance rate of 52.61%.
